2. Adventurequest - Explore the pristine northern Rocky Mountain wilderness with our action packed summer outdoor adventure programs. We travel through The Grand Tetons, Yellowstone National Park, and Montana's Big Sky country offering a multi-dimensional experience focusing on fun friendship, teamwork, and leadership.

Exciting outdoor adventures include: mountain biking, whitewater rafting, whitewater kayaking, rock climbing, fly fishing, orienteering, canoeing, mountaineering, backpacking, hiking, wildlife watching and photography, swimming, hot springs, sightseeing and more! Our staff is well trained to ensure a safe camp experience.

Camping with Adventurequest provides a great and unique environment for young people to learn and grow. Campers participate in cooking group meals, pitching camp, making daily activity choices, etc...

Traveling and camping is a great way to explore the wild west. Adventurequest travels in new fifteen passenger vans driven by our mature and proffessional staff that is atleast twenty five years old with a clean driving record, and yes, the vans have CD players! Most of our travels are short, but there are a few times we will need to travel greater distances making the longest ride about three hours long. (It's a big country).

Our campgrounds are a mix of front country National Forest and National Park sites with all the amenities, and some of the most spectacular primitive backountry campsites in the rockies. Typically we stay at these campgrounds three to five nights before we pack up and move on to our next adventure. Showers and laundry are available at some of the campsites, and we stop periodically along the way when they are not available. Phone calls will be made at previously schedualed times so that parents can anticipate and plan to be available to take the calls.

Food is essential! Our gourmet camp menu has everything from standard hamburger and hot dog cook outs to freshly baked breads and cakes! Thats right! you can learn how to bake cakes, lasagna, and anything else you can whip up in your kitchen at home! The campers prepare and cook all breakfasts and dinners. Everyday it will be a different team of two or three campers and one of the guides who get to try thier culinary skills. The results are delicious! Lunches are usually made at breakfast from a nutritious spread of sandwiches, fruit, trailmix and other popular foods to be packed in our daypacks and taken along on our daily adventure.

Daily camp life is fun and easy. Campers are given choices and challenge themselves with each activity. Our guides are highly skilled providing a safe opportunity for campers to try new things. At the end of each day while sitting around the camp fire we reflect on the great accomplishments and achievements both by individuals and those of our group. By the time everyone has told thier stories, the campfire has burned down, millions of brilliant stars fill the sky, and everyone is ready for bed so that they can recharge for another exciting day.

Adventurequest is a small locally owned and operated camp dedicated to enriching young lives. Our programs, with a four to one camper to guide ratio, provide a higher quality experience other large scale, non-local camps cannot match. Through excellent leadership and a personalized approach to learning Adventurequest has achieved outstanding results.
